About

Lobley Hill and Bensham form a residential ward situated directly across the River Tyne from Newcastle city centre. The area is primarily composed of Victorian and Edwardian terraced housing, with some modern developments. Its topography is varied, featuring the steep incline of Lobley Hill itself alongside the flatter streets of Bensham closer to the river. This creates a distinct separation between the two neighbourhoods within the shared ward.

The area is well-connected by several major roads, including the A184, and is served by the Gateshead Stadium Metro station. Bensham is notable for its long-established Orthodox Jewish community, one of the largest in the UK outside London, with several synagogues and kosher facilities. The ward also contains Saltwell Park, a large Victorian park with a restored Gothic revival mansion, providing a significant green space for local residents.

Area overview

On average Lobley Hill and Bensham has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 147 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, roughly 1.3× the North East average of 117 per 1,000. Approximately 41.2%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Lobley Hill and Bensham is £41,912 per year. There are 2 schools in Lobley Hill and Bensham: 2 primary (1 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). Lobley Hill and Bensham is home to around 10,053 people, with a population density of about 2,587.3 per km².

Based on 85 recent sales, the median property price is £161,000 (about £172 per square foot) in Lobley Hill and Bensham area, with individual transactions ranging from £40,000 up to £332,000.
